Time Complexity: Recursion depth is k and at each level, we have 9 digits to choose from.
O(k * 9^k)
Space Complexity: Ignoring the result array, we used ArrayList of size k to store intermediate state O(k)
Problem link: https://leetcode.com/problems/combination-sum-iii/
Java Code link: https://github.com/niteshnanda02/Leetcode/blob/master/216-combination-sum-iii/216-combination-sum-iii.java
๐๐ฒ๐ฒ๐น ๐ณ๐ฟ๐ฒ๐ฒ ๐๐ผ ๐ฐ๐ผ๐บ๐บ๐ฒ๐ป๐ ๐ถ๐ณ ๐๐ผ๐ ๐ต๐ฎ๐๐ฒ ๐ฎ๐ป๐ ๐ฑ๐ผ๐๐ฏ๐๐ ๐ฎ๐ฏ๐ผ๐๐ ๐๐ต๐ฒ ๐ฐ๐ผ๐ฑ๐ฒ ๐ผ๐ฟ ๐๐ต๐ฒ ๐น๐ผ๐ด๐ถ๐ฐ!!
๐ดTelegram group
https://t.me/+ac96uKT3mow5ZWJl
๐ดMy contact details
LinkedIn: https://www.linkedin.com/in/nitesh-nanda-2590a6172/
Twitter: https://twitter.com/Nitesh_Nanda_
Instagram: https://www.instagram.com/nitesh_nanda_/
#Backtracking
#Array
#Medium
#ConsitencyChallenge
#DataStructuresAndAlgorithms
#Leetcode
#NiteshNanda
Download
0 formats
No download links available.
Combination Sum III | Leetcode 216 | Backtracking | Array | Medium | NatokHD